Talk to a Human

We promise, your message won’t disappear into the abyss. We’re standing by and ready to help with any questions, comments, or thoughts you may have.

Let’s Chat!

icon 01

Where We Are

36 Rue du Dr Mauran, 06800 Cagnes-sur-Mer, France

icon 02

24/7 Tech Support

+1(332) 322-7167